This volume surveys the development of combinatorics since 1930 by presenting in chronological order the fundamental results of the subject proved in over five decades of original papers by: T. van Aardenne-Ehrenfest.- R.L. Brooks.- N.G. de Bruijn.- G.F. Clements.- H.H. Crapo.- R.P. Dilworth.- J. Edmonds.- P. Erd?s.- L.R. Ford, Jr.- D.R. Fulkerson.- D. Gale.- L. Geissinger.- I.J. Good.- R.L. Graham.- A.W. Hales.- P. Hall.- P.R. Halmos.- R.I. Jewett.- I. Kaplansky.- P.W. Kasteleyn.- G. Katona.- D.J. Kleitman.- K. Leeb.- B. Lindstr?m.- L. Lov?sz.- D. Lubell.- C. St. J.A. Nash-Williams.- G. P?lya.-R. Rado.- F.P. Ramsey.- G.-C. Rota.- B.L. Rothschild.- H.J. Ryser.- C. Schensted.- M.P. Sch?tzenberger.- R.P. Stanley.- G. Szekeres.- W.T. Tutte.- H.E. Vaughan.- H. Whitney.

This volume surveys the development of combinatorics since 1930 by presenting in chronological order the fundamental results of the subject proved in over five decades of original papers.

On a Problem of Formal Logic.- Non-Separable and Planar Graphs*.- A Combinatorial Problem in Geometry.- On Representatives of Subsets.- On the Abstract Properties of Linear Dependence1.- The Dissection of Rectangles Into Squares.- On Colouring the Nodes of a Network.- Solution of the Probl?me Des M?nages.- A Ring in Graph Theory.- A Decomposition Theorem for Partially Ordered Sets.- The Marriage Problem*.- Circuits and Trees in Oriented Linear Graphs.- The Factors of Graphs.- A Partition Calculus in Set Theory.- Maximal Flow Through a Network.- On Picture-Writing*.- A Theorem on Flows in Networks.- Combinatorial Properties of Matrices of Zeros and Ones.- Graph Theory and Probability.- The Statistics of Dimers on a Lattice.- Longest Increasing and Decreasing Subsequences.- On a Theorem of R.
